Emma Stridh from Beckmans College of Design has received Svenskt Tenn’s annual design scholarship for her “Ground Settings” graduation project. The work represents the design of a meal with clay, wood, metal, linen and glass as the raw materials. The final result is now on display at Svenskt Tenn’s store on Strandvägen in Stockholm.
